Glorification Of Crime



In today's society, murder, rape, suicide, gang warfare, riots, drive-by shootings and other graphic depictions of violence are no further away than the nearest remote control. All of these images and more can be viewed from the comfort of one's own home on television. In recent times we have witnessed a new trend in media which is re enactment of criminal events.  Currently almost all channels which are showing similar crime events with all the attractive contents and other spicy material. Initially the main objective of these programs was to aware viewers of the criminal events and the motto behind them. However it has been observed that the effect it is creating on public’s mind is that they are getting aware of different ways to take revenge from their enemies and to make quick money. Many people are seen discussing the idea of becoming ‘ROBIN HOOD’ in today’s tough times. Recession, job insecurity and inflation are the elements which is making everyone depressed and aggressive. Therefore these programs are not helping much in mitigation of inflation and depression in one’s life. We can analyze the recent increase in the crime and increase in the episodes of such programs. People are actually sitting with their families to watch these re enactments crimes like Tele Theater or FIR series. When drama is based on reality and is giving the impression that a life of crime is something to be admired, then I think there are problems. It is glorifying something that is wrong."
 


Due to these ill effects, parents should preach their children not to watch these programs as they can have negative impact on their innocent minds.
